mirror of
https://github.com/linux-apfs/apfstests.git
synced 2026-05-01 15:01:44 -07:00
Allow parallel builds of the xfstests package
Merge of master-melb:xfs-cmds:32515a by kenmcd. Allow parallel builds of the xfstests package
This commit is contained in:
@@ -122,14 +122,6 @@ INSTALL_LINGUAS = \
|
||||
done
|
||||
endif
|
||||
|
||||
SUBDIRS_MAKERULE = \
|
||||
@for d in $(SUBDIRS) ""; do \
|
||||
if test -d "$$d" -a ! -z "$$d"; then \
|
||||
$(ECHO) === $$d ===; \
|
||||
$(MAKEF) -C $$d $@ || exit $$?; \
|
||||
fi; \
|
||||
done
|
||||
|
||||
MAN_MAKERULE = \
|
||||
@for f in *.[12345678] ""; do \
|
||||
if test ! -z "$$f"; then \
|
||||
|
||||
+11
-5
@@ -6,16 +6,20 @@ _BUILDRULES_INCLUDED_ = 1
|
||||
|
||||
include $(TOPDIR)/include/builddefs
|
||||
|
||||
clean clobber : $(SUBDIRS)
|
||||
clean clobber : $(addsuffix -clean,$(SUBDIRS))
|
||||
rm -f $(DIRT)
|
||||
@rm -fr .libs
|
||||
$(SUBDIRS_MAKERULE)
|
||||
|
||||
%-clean:
|
||||
$(MAKE) -C $* clean
|
||||
|
||||
# Never blow away subdirs
|
||||
ifdef SUBDIRS
|
||||
.PRECIOUS: $(SUBDIRS)
|
||||
.PHONY: $(SUBDIRS)
|
||||
|
||||
$(SUBDIRS):
|
||||
$(SUBDIRS_MAKERULE)
|
||||
$(MAKE) -C $@
|
||||
endif
|
||||
|
||||
#
|
||||
@@ -68,11 +72,13 @@ ifdef LTLIBRARY
|
||||
DEPENDSCRIPT := $(DEPENDSCRIPT) | $(SED) -e 's,^\([^:]*\)\.o,\1.lo,'
|
||||
endif
|
||||
|
||||
depend : $(CFILES) $(HFILES)
|
||||
$(SUBDIRS_MAKERULE)
|
||||
depend : $(CFILES) $(HFILES) $(addsuffix -depend,$(SUBDIRS))
|
||||
$(DEPENDSCRIPT) > .dep
|
||||
test -s .dep || rm -f .dep
|
||||
|
||||
%-depend:
|
||||
$(MAKE) -C $* depend
|
||||
|
||||
# Include dep, but only if it exists
|
||||
ifeq ($(shell test -f .dep && echo .dep), .dep)
|
||||
include .dep
|
||||
|
||||
Reference in New Issue
Block a user